Handover Note — Logistics Transition

From: Director M. Calverros, to Director E. Tindale. As of next quarter we move fulfilment from Brenholt Freight to Ostermark Logistics. Finance should note the revised invoicing cadence (fortnightly, not monthly), the 4% handling surcharge on cold-chain items, and the pending Brenholt exit settlement. Please reconcile open purchase orders before cutover. The strategic rationale is set out confidentially below.

internal memo for kawip-hadug: Headcount on the Wenwyn team goes from 7 to 140 by the end of January. Gross margin on Wenwyn came in at 20 percent against a plan of 15 percent.

## Onboarding: Calendar Sync Conflicts

If you see duplicate or phantom meetings, the usual culprit is the Meridale sync worker racing the Clockhollow webhook handler. Both write to the same event table, and when a recurring event is edited mid-sync, the worker can resurrect the stale version. First step: pause the worker via the admin console, then replay the webhook queue. To replay, you'll need to call the Clockhollow internal replay endpoint directly, which authenticates with the service key below.

gateway credential: kto23_LX9A4ys6i4nzHtpOLNLodKK

# This fixture feeds the translation-string extraction script used by the
# Orvale localization pipeline. Support folks: if a customer reports a
# missing translation, re-run the extractor against this fixture first to
# confirm the key is detected before filing a bug with the Linnet team.
# To pull the latest string catalog from the staging service, authenticate
# with the token below.

session JWT of yawep-yawep = eyJhbGciOiJIUzI1NiIsInR5cCI6IkpXVCJ9.eyJzdWIiOiI3pWF3_In0.aXYsHiog